RSC 🩵 July

The Rainbow Scrap Challenge color for July is aqua. My RSC goal this year is to whittle down my stack of 5" scrap charm squares by turning them into baby quilts, 9 squares across by 11 squares down, therefore "99 Charms" quilts. Here are the two I made for July.
My Quilt Info #1:
Pattern: 99 Charms
Size: 41" x 50"
Batting: Quilters Dream 100% Cotton
Thread: Glide--Light Turquoise
Pantograph: Ba Da Bing ⤵️ from Urban Elementz
"Ba Da Bing" is a fun, celebratory quilting design! 
This penguin backing fabric comes from an IKEA duvet cover.
I love these cool, beachy, calming colors!
My Quilt Info #2:
Pattern: 99 Charms
Size: 41" x 50"
Batting: Quilters Dream 100% Cotton
Thread: Glide--Light Turquoise
Pantograph: Dreaming ⤵️ from OESD
I had enough of these aqua, turquoise, teal, and sea foam colored charm squares to make 2 baby quilts.
"Dreaming" is a fun, unusual sort of meander! 
So many memories tied to each of these "scrap" charm squares!
The IKEA penguin duvet cover was in the children's department. It is twin size and gave me enough fabric to back 4 baby quilts total, with some piecing.
I split the charms squares equally between the two quilts, so they look pretty similiar.
